Proton Satria GTi the Malaysian Hatchback

The Proton Satria is a hatchback produced by Malaysian automaker, Proton. It was first introduced in 1994 and was in production until 2005. The Satria was available in both three and five-door configurations and was powered by a variety of engines ranging from 1.3-liter to 1.8-liter four-cylinder options.

One of the most notable versions of the Proton Satria is the GTi model. This version was introduced in 1998 and was powered by a 1.8-liter four-cylinder engine, similar to the Mitsubishi Lancer GSR. The Satria GTi was a popular choice in the World Rally Championship, where it competed against other heavy hitters such as the Subaru WRX STi and Mitsubishi Evo.
